<nc-section data-title="Version 1: The Iron Gaze" data-color="red"> I dismounted Thunder near the stables, my legs trembling slightly from the long ride. Before I could even gather my belongings, a towering figure emerged from the shadows of the stable archway. Sir Roland, the local knight, stood with arms crossed over his chest, his weathered face revealing nothing of his thoughts. His armor bore the scratches of countless battles, and his eyes—grey as storm clouds—studied me with an intensity that made my breath catch. "So you're the boy they sent me," he said, his voice like grinding stone. "Frederick of Harrowdale, I presume?" He stepped closer, and I caught the scent of leather and iron that clung to him like a second skin. "I've broken squires before my morning meal, boy. We'll see if you're made of sterner stuff." Despite his harsh words, something flickered in his eyes—perhaps curiosity, perhaps hope. </nc-section> <nc-section data-title="Version 2: An Unexpected Kindness" data-color="green"> The stable boy took Thunder's reins as I dismounted, and I turned to find a knight watching me from beside the great oak doors. Sir Roland was not what I had imagined. Where I expected a grizzled warrior, I found a man with laugh lines etched deep around his eyes and a warm smile breaking through his salt-and-pepper beard. "Frederick! At last!" he boomed, striding forward to clasp my shoulder with a hand that could have crushed stone, yet gripped me with surprising gentleness. "Your father wrote to me before he passed. He asked me to look after you, to teach you what he could not." His voice softened. "You have his eyes, you know. Come, you must be famished. We'll speak of training on the morrow—tonight, you eat at my table." I felt something in my chest unclench for the first time in months. </nc-section> <nc-section data-title="Version 3: Whispers of the Dragon" data-color="blue"> Dusk had settled over the castle when I led Thunder into the stables, and that was when I noticed the knight standing apart from the others, his gaze fixed on the distant mountains where the last shadows of daylight bled into darkness. Sir Roland did not turn as I approached, though I knew he had heard me. A knight like him missed nothing. "You came from the eastern road," he said quietly. "Then you saw them—the burned fields, the villages emptied of their people." Only then did he turn, and I saw the exhaustion carved into his features, the weight of some great burden pressing upon his shoulders. "They say a dragon has awakened in the northern peaks. The first in three hundred years." His hand rested on the pommel of his sword, an old habit worn smooth by time. "Tell me, young Frederick—do you believe in dragons? Because in a fortnight, you may not have the luxury of disbelief." </nc-section>
